Evergreen Park has gone a perfect 3-0 against Crete-Monee recently and they'll look to pad the win column further on Monday. Evergreen Park will welcome Crete-Monee at 4:30 p.m. Evergreen Park knows how to get runs on the board -- the squad has finished with ten runs or more in their past three contests -- so hopefully Crete-Monee likes a good challenge.
Evergreen Park's pitching crew heads into the matchup hoping to repeat the dominance they displayed on Saturday. They put the hurt on Lisle with a sharp 13-0 win.
Noah Munoz was a major factor no matter where he played. On the mound, he didn't allow a single earned run and allowed only one hit over five innings pitched. Munoz was also solid in the batter's box, scoring three runs while getting on base in all three of his plate appearances.
In other batting news, Evergreen Park got a massive performance out of Rowan Smyth, who scored three runs and stole a base while going 2-for-2. That's the most hits Smyth has posted since back in May of 2024. Caleb Keyser was another key player, scoring a run and stealing a base while going 3-for-3.
Evergreen Park always had someone on base and finished the game having posted an OBP of .552. That was just more of the same: they've now posted an OBP of .552 or higher every time they've taken the field this season.
Meanwhile, Crete-Monee suffered their closest loss since April 13, 2024 on Saturday. They fell just short of Herscher by a score of 6-4.
Bren Milburn was cooking despite his team's loss, scoring a run and stealing three bases while going 2-for-4. Another player making a difference was Anthony Monegan, who scored a run and stole two bases while getting on base in all three of his plate appearances.
Evergreen Park pushed their record up to 3-0 with the victory, which was their fifth straight at home dating back to last season. The wins came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 2.0 runs on average over those games. As for Crete-Monee, they now have a losing record of 1-2.
Crete-Monee's pitching crew has a crucial task ahead of them: Evergreen Park hasn't had any issues making contact this season, having earned a batting average of .507. It's a different story for Crete-Monee, though, as they've only averaged .222. Will they be able to contain Evergreen Park's hitters?
Evergreen Park took their victory against Crete-Monee in their previous meeting back in May of 2024 by a conclusive 10-0. Will Evergreen Park repeat their success, or does Crete-Monee has a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
